The Multichain team announced via Twitter on Thursday that it has integrated with the Near Protocol. The integration will enable thousands of users and developers to interact with the NEAR ecosystem seamlessly and freely with a 0% cross-chain fee charged. The integration enables USDT, USDC, and wBTC, among others, to be bridged between NEAR and 15 other chains, including Ethereum, Polygon, BNB, Arbitrum, and Avalanche. 

Multichain, previously known as Anyswap, is a decentralized cross-chain swap protocol and bridge infrastructure. The Multichain platform supports multiple blockchains, which enables users to swap and bridge tokens across numerous chains on one platform.

NEAR Protocol is a decentralized application platform designed to make apps similarly usable to those on today’s web. The network runs on a Proof-of-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ism called Nightshade, which aims to provide dynamic scalability and stabilize fees.NEAR is trading at $1.753, up by more than 2% in the last 24 hours.
